Description
Black and white autographed photograph portrait of Elmer Ellsworth Brown to Oscar Tschirky, with an inscription reading: "To my good friend, Oscar, from Elmer Ellsworth Brown 1933". Mr. Ellsworth Brown was an American educator and most notably the Chancellor of New York University where he founded NYU Press.
